The Delhi government’s move to implement mandatory e-KYC verification appears focused on ensuring accurate delivery of welfare schemes by identifying active beneficiaries. Updating records after a decade reflects the necessity of streamlining public databases amid changing socio-economic conditions. While this step promotes openness and efficiency, the reliance on digital platforms might pose challenges for individuals without internet access or technical proficiency. Additionally, setting a strict deadline could lead to rushed compliance efforts among beneficiaries.
